Output 6309ef0b71c79ed9e28d983004013c9df4bd4aa993e7dc99483e5dbd59419cb6:1

value
13019214
script pubkey
OP_HASH160 OP_PUSHBYTES_20 200dceb5b3cd270bead80229dd0e34e534e020c2 OP_EQUAL
address
34cW63Mm6g8nnbzvpNRGRfYALrm3GSBK3a
transaction
6309ef0b71c79ed9e28d983004013c9df4bd4aa993e7dc99483e5dbd59419cb6
spent
true